The Community Health Foundation’s annual Meal to Heal fundraiser is set for Saturday, April 22 from 6:30 pm to 9 pm at the Summit Room in City Central located at 400 E. Central Ave. in downtown Ponca City.

This year, El Patio will be catering the event with chicken and steak fajitas, rice and beans, and chips and queso. The event will also feature frozen margaritas and beer on tap from Vortex Alley Brewing, as well as a live auction and raffle prizes.

Meal to Heal raises funds for the Foundation’s grants and scholarships. Every year, the Foundation awards almost $40,000 in scholarships to students from Kay County pursuing a degree or career in healthcare.

This year, nursing students at Northern Oklahoma College (NOC) and Pioneer Technology Center (PTC) have received $16,000 in scholarships, students in the Bachelor’s of Science program at the University Center (UC) have received $3000 in scholarships, and $4000 was awarded to a variety of specialties from pre-dentistry, pre-physical therapy, and health and sports science.

The Foundation accepts grant applications every year from organizations throughout Kay County with a focus on improving health. Grant recipients included the community medical equipment loan program at Hospice of North Central Oklahoma, NERA, the family resource program at Northern Oklahoma Youth Shelter, Survivor Resource Network, the school pantry and elementary backpack programs in Kay County through the Regional Food Bank of Oklahoma, the Blackwell Middle School Backpack food program, the United Way prescription assistance program, RSVP (a program for senior adults), Dearing House and Edwin Fair.
